Outline of Final Research Achievements |
Onji is an important crude drug for demantia, and onjisaponins are suggested to contribute for the activity. In the present study, important enzyme genes responsible for onjisaponin biosynthesis in Polygala tenuifolia were examined by transcriptomic analyses based on next generation sequencing techniques. As results, a series of gene candidates responsible for saponin biosynthesis has been identified, and characterized their functions. in conclusion, it has been found that important enzyme genes responsible for onjisaponin biosynthesis.
